Argentina said Tuesday it had reached an agreement with the Paris Club of creditor countries, avoiding a default on repayment in July and unlocking relief of some $2 billion. "We have reached an understanding with the Paris Club" to avoid defaulting on July 31, when a grace period was to expire for the repayment of a tranche of debt of about $2.4 billion, Economy Minister Martin Guzman told reporters. nn/mlr/bfm
